中文摘要
      根据西安市各类氨排放源活动水平数据,采用合理的估算方法和排放因子,建立了2013年西安市人为源大气氨排放清单. 结果表明,2013年西安市人为源大气氨排放量为47.17×103 t,排放强度为4.57 t·km-2;畜禽养殖和氮肥施用是排放贡献最大的两个人为源,氨排放量分别为20.55×103 t和17.51×103 t,占排放总量的80.68%;畜禽养殖中,牛和猪是最大的排放源,占畜禽养殖排放总量的75.03%;临潼区是排放量最大行政区,排放量为10.73×103 t,分担率为23.22%;阎良区的排放强度最大,达到14.75 t·km-2.
英文摘要
      Based on the activity data of diverse ammonia sources, the rational estimation method and emission factors were employed, and an anthropogenic ammonia emission inventory was further established to describe the situation of Xi'an in 2013.The results showed that the total anthropogenic ammonia emission reached 47.17×103 t in 2013 with an emission intensity of 4.57 t·km-2; The livestock breeding and nitrogen fertilizers were the major sources of anthropogenic ammonia emission, which were 20.55×103 t and 17.51×103 t, respectively, accounting for 80.68% in total; Cow and hog were the major sources, and occupied 75.03% in livestock breeding emission; Lintong District was the heaviest emission area, the total emission was 10.73×103 t, which accounted for 23.22%; The emission intensity of Yanliang District reached 14.75 t·km-2 which was considered as the most severe area.
